## 3.2.0 — Changed Defaults

Prosecheck, the documentation linter, now enforces sentence-case headings and flags passive voice by default. Previously both rules were opt-in; most repos had enabled them anyway, so the default flipped to match common practice. Reviewers should expect new warnings on older docs that haven't been touched in a while — these are not regressions. To restore the old behavior per-repo, override the shipped defaults, which are now as follows.

config for tagep-yajef:
ulawyn:
  log_level: error
  metrics_host: metrics.ulawyn.lumiclabs.internal
  pin: 0564
  pool_size: 32

Management Meeting Minutes — Logistics Transition

Attendees: ops, finance, procurement leads. Decision: terminate Harvane Freight contract at quarter end; award regional distribution to Corlis Logistics. Rationale: 12% cost reduction, better cold-chain coverage from the Drayfold hub. Finance to model transition costs and update accruals by Friday. No external communication until contracts signed. Penalty exposure on early exit deemed acceptable. Risk register updated. Strategic context for the board is recorded below.

management briefing: The pricing group signed off on a budget of $378.8 million for Project Kasael.

## Changelog — Font vendoring defaults changed

As of this release, the Bracken UI build no longer fetches third-party fonts at build time. All typefaces used by the Lanternwell suite are now vendored into the repo under a dedicated assets directory, and the fetch step is skipped by default. If you're onboarding, nothing to install — the fonts travel with the checkout. The build flags controlling this behavior are listed below.

settings of hadup-yafog:
LAMAEL_PIN=3761
LAMAEL_TENANT=istmir
LAMAEL_METRICS_HOST=metrics.lamael.plorvasys.test
LAMAEL_SEAL=seal_8ea68500
LAMAEL_STANDBY_TEAM=fraok